Dominion Payroll is an American workforce management company operating under the SaaS and technology categories. It provides payroll, HR, time, and talent solutions to employers ranging from 5 to 5,000 employees across all 50 states and all industries. The company positions itself as customer-focused, combining industry-leading software with dedicated human support. It also emphasizes community involvement and a commitment to making a positive impact.

Dominion Payroll offers workforce management solutions spanning four primary areas: payroll, HR (human resources), time management, and talent solutions. These services are delivered via industry-leading SaaS-based software and are described as custom-fitted to each client's unique business needs. The company targets employers across all industries and sizes, ranging from 5 to 5,000 employees. Beyond software, it provides dedicated human support as part of its service model.
